Re: New project : 72 Suburban

The last couple of months the Suburban has gone through yet more changes under the hood. The old combination which made the LS look like an old school big block was just not working bc of the size and weight of the vehicle. So I took all of that off and drug out the stock 6.0 intake and TB from under the workbench. Removed the stock injectors and replaced them with a set of 50# truck injectors from GM and bought a cheap CAI from Amazon. That was just what the doctor ordered. We are currently cleaning up the tune and so far it runs better than it ever has. Now I am in the process of cleaning up and painting the stock LS components that I installed back on the engine. Valve covers and coil packs are cleaned up and painted and some of the wiring is tucked away where it belongs. Today my engine/coil pack covers from Special Ops Motorsports came and I managed to get the pieces fitted and painted. Next up is to remove the intake and get it painted while the covers are being pinstriped. More updates to follow. I am hoping to have this project wrapped up for the 4th of July show I plan on attending.
